Digital Noise Filter Mode Status Field (MSEL = 001B)
NE—Noise Event
This bit is asserted if digital noise is detected on the receive data line while the data is
sampled (center of bit time). If this bit is set, it does not mean that the receive data is
corrupted (in extreme cases), just that one or more of the noise filter data samples near the
center of the bit time did not match the average data value.
LIN Mode Status Field (MSEL = 010B)
NE—Noise event
This bit is asserted if some noise level is detected on the receive data line when the data is
sampled (center of bit time). If this bit is set, it does not indicate that the receive data is
corrupt (in extreme cases), just that one or more of the 16x data samples near the center of
the bit time did not match the average data value.
RxBreakLength—LIN mode received break length. This field is read following a break
(LIN WAKE-UP or BREAK) so software determines the measured duration of the break. If
the break exceeds 15 bit times the value saturates at
